This manual introduces in detail the functions, installation and operation for this PTZ camera.
Please read this manual carefully before installation and use.
1. Cautions
1.1 Avoid damage to product caused by heavy pressure, strong vibration or immersion during
transportation, storage and installation.
1.2 Housing of this product is made of organic materials. Do not expose it to any liquid, gas or solids
which may corrode the shell.
1.3 Do not expose the product to rain or moisture.
1.4 To prevent the risk of electric shock, do not open the case. Installation and maintenance should only
be carried out by qualified technicians.
1.5 Do not use the product beyond the specified temperature, humidity or power supply specifications.
1.6 Wipe it with a soft, dry cloth when cleaning the camera lens. Wipe it gently with a mild detergent if
needed. Do not use strong or corrosive detergents to avoid scratching the lens and affecting the
image.
1.7 This product contains no parts which can be maintained by users themselves. Any damage caused
by dismantling the product by user without permission is not covered by warranty.
2. Electrical Safety
Installation and use of this product must strictly comply with local electrical safety standards.
The power supply of the product is ±12V, the max electrical current is 2A .
3. Install
3.1 Do not rotate the camera head violently, otherwise it may cause mechanical failure.
3.2 This product should be placed on a stable desktop or other horizontal surface. Do not install the
product obliquely, otherwise it may display inclined image.
3.3 Ensure there are no obstacles within rotation range of the holder.
3.4 Do not power on before completely installation.
4. Magnetic Interference
Electromagnetic fields at specific frequencies may affect the video image. This product is Class A. It may
cause radio interference in household application. Appropriate measure is required.

The default address selected by the remote control is 1. When the remote control transmits a signal
to the camera, the status indicator light on the camera flashes green;
If the remote-control address selection is wrong, the indicator light does not flash and the remote
control address is invalid.

1.2 Interfaces and Connection
Figure 1.3 Wiring Diagram
1) After power on and self-warming, the camera will automatically return to the preset 0 position if it’s
pre-set.
2) The default address for the IR remote control is 1#. If the menu restored to factory defaults, the
remote-control default address will restore to 1#.
